In the presence of LPS at level 1, a bacteriostatic phase was followed by growth, whereas at a higher level, a bactericidic phase was observed. Nisin response was time-and pH-dependent. Nisin was bactericidic at acidic pH values and for a short incubation time (12 h) only; then, a re-growth phase was observed. Nisin and LPS in combination gave an original response which lacked the transitory bactericidal effect of Nisin and had a continuously bactericidal affect, leading to 10 cfu ml −1 of L. monocytogenes at 144 h; the response was greatly affected by incubation time. Predicted values were in good agreement with experimental values. Response Surface Methodology is a useful experimental approach for rapid testing of the effects of inhibitors.
Litchi chinensis (Sapindaceae) is a tree that originates from China and is cultivated for its sweet fruits all over the world in warm climates. Unusual fatty acids such as cyclopropanoic fatty acids have been identified in the seeds of Litchi. Because of their potential value for industry (as inks, cosmetics, detergents, lubricants, etc.), the variability in the relative levels of unusual fatty acids in the seeds of 28 different Litchi varieties was analysed at two locations (on Réunion Island in the Indian Ocean) and on two different harvest dates. Except for one variety, all the seeds contained cis-9,10-methylene-octadecanoic acid (C(19)CA) at a relative level of 35-48%. The only variety that contained no or only traces of C(19)CA was Groff, seeds of which were significantly much smaller than those from all other varieties.
